
If you’ve noticed your likes, comments, and shares slipping over the past year, you’re not alone. Across platforms, engagement rates are dropping. Business owners often blame “the algorithm,” but the truth is more complex. In 2025, audience behavior, platform saturation, and content preferences all play a role in how (and if) your posts perform.
The good news? Engagement isn’t dead—it’s just evolving. Here’s why engagement is dropping, and more importantly, what you can do about it.
1. Content Fatigue Is Real
Audiences are overloaded. Every brand, influencer, and competitor is posting nonstop. As a result, users scroll past more posts without reacting.
Solution:
- Quality over quantity. A few meaningful posts outperform daily filler.
- Use storytelling—highlight customer wins, behind-the-scenes content, or employee spotlights.
- Embrace micro-content—short, punchy updates that respect attention spans.
2. The Rise of Short-Form Video
Instagram Reels, TikTok, and YouTube Shorts dominate. Static graphics still have a place, but video wins the algorithm’s attention and holds viewers longer.
Solution:
- Repurpose blogs into short video tips.
- Use captions and trending audio.
- Showcase products/services in action, not just images.
3. Timing and Frequency Shifts
What worked in 2022 doesn’t work now. Posting daily at noon no longer guarantees traction.
Solution:
- Test different posting times using platform analytics.
- Focus on when your audience is active, not industry averages.
- Don’t fear posting less often if each post delivers higher value.
4. Engagement Beyond Likes
Engagement isn’t just likes anymore. Saves, shares, clicks, and DMs now signal stronger interest to algorithms than a simple double-tap.
Solution:
- Ask for action: “Save this for later,” “DM us for details,” “Share with a friend.”
- Create carousel posts with step-by-step tips people want to revisit.
- Offer exclusive value in exchange for interaction (free guides, discounts).
5. Paid and Organic Must Work Together
Organic reach is shrinking. Platforms are designed to push businesses toward paid ads—but that doesn’t mean you need a huge budget.
Solution:
- Boost top-performing organic posts with small ad spend.
- Use retargeting to reach warm audiences.
- Test low-budget campaigns before scaling.
6. Authenticity Still Wins
Audiences spot stock content and generic captions instantly. In 2025, authenticity—real stories, real people, real struggles—connects best.
Solution:
- Show your face, your team, your customers.
- Lean into imperfect content: live videos, casual phone clips.
- Humanize your brand voice—write like you’d talk to a friend.
Conclusion
Social media engagement isn’t falling because your audience stopped caring—it’s because the digital landscape is shifting. If you pivot with them—embracing video, prioritizing authenticity, and blending organic with paid—you’ll not only reclaim engagement but deepen your connection with customers.
